Transaction 6875787f0f8a13e2150ad3e12e4806ca84b5bdc7a92d8978c6c7fc727fe312ec
1 Input
2 Outputs
- 6875787f0f8a13e2150ad3e12e4806ca84b5bdc7a92d8978c6c7fc727fe312ec:0
- 6875787f0f8a13e2150ad3e12e4806ca84b5bdc7a92d8978c6c7fc727fe312ec:1
value 4881597
address 3AjNsvyXFgVzmjLAUyRfh91qwa4GGfc65x
value 39250267
address 3NjwsukRw5ND5BdGtJqS88GXZG9Pv595Ja